Seminar & Forum 6th 10+3 Media Cooperation Forum held in Kunming, China 2013.12.06

On December 6, 2013, more than 200 representatives from 45 newspapers, television stations and news agencies in the ASEAN and Plus Three countries attended the Sixth 10+3 Media Cooperation Forum held by the People’s Daily of China, in Kunming of Yunnan.


President of the People's Daily Mr. ZHANG Yannong, Governor of Yunnan Province Mr. LI Jiheng, Deputy Secretary-General of the ASEAN Secretariat Dr. Mochtan Achmad Kurnia Prawira, media representatives and officials from 10+3 countries have attended the Forum and delivered remarks. Trilateral Cooperation Secretariat (TCS) participated in the Forum for the first time and briefed the delegates on the progress of the trilateral cooperation and TCS itself.


Under the theme of “Chinese Dream, Asian Dream”, the media representatives held in-depth discussion on various topics including “Media’s Role: Positive Energy and a New Harmonious Asia”, “Asia’s Voice: Local Perspective and Global Vision” and “Yunnan in the ‘Asian Century’: Gateway to Opportunities and Win-win Development”. They agreed on the responsibilities of the media in presenting accurate and rational reports, in order to create a favorable environment for enhancing the mutual trust and understanding of Asia. They also agreed to strengthen the media cooperation among Asian countries to expand the international influence of the region.


Before the Forum, Secretary of the CPC Yunan Provincial Committee Mr. QIN Guangrong held a meeting with the participants, introducing the cooperation progress of Yunnan province with ASEAN Plus Three countries, expecting to further strengthen exchanges, achieving mutual benefit and win-win outcomes.


The Forum has been hosted by the People’s Daily of China annually since 2007, inviting representatives from mainstream media organizations from ASEAN and Plus Three countries to enhance exchanges among the mass media of East Asia.
